Case Study - Legacy to Cloud: 5TB Migration for a Betting Platform with Luce
A data migration solution for a high-volume betting platform, moving 5TB of operational data from legacy MySQL systems to cloud-native architecture with minimal downtime.
- Client
- Betting Platform
- Year
- Service
- Data Migration, Cloud Architecture, Legacy Modernization

Executive Summary
In February 2026, We executed a critical data migration for a high-volume betting platform, moving 5TB of operational data from legacy MySQL systems to a cloud-native architecture. The project achieved zero data loss, production-grade uptime during migration, and 50% performance improvement while establishing a scalable foundation for future growth.
The Challenge: MySQL Bottlenecks in Operational Systems
The betting platform faced critical performance and scalability challenges:
System Bottlenecks
- Database Performance: MySQL struggling with 10M+ daily transactions
- Query Latency: 5-10 second response times during peak hours
- Storage Limitations: 5TB data approaching hardware capacity limits
- Backup Issues: 8+ hour backup windows causing operational constraints
- Scaling Problems: Vertical scaling no longer cost-effective
Business Impact
- User Experience: Slow response times affecting betting experience
- Revenue Loss: System downtime during peak betting hours
- Operational Costs: Expensive hardware maintenance and upgrades
- Competitive Disadvantage: Unable to support new features and markets
- Risk Management: Single points of failure in critical systems
Technical Constraints
- Legacy Architecture: Monolithic MySQL setup with limited flexibility
- Data Volume: 5TB of historical and real-time betting data
- Zero-Downtime Requirement: Critical for 24/7 betting operations
- Data Consistency: Complex relationships across betting, user, and financial data
- Compliance Requirements: Gaming regulations and audit trails
Solution: Migration Strategy
We implemented a migration strategy using modern data stack technologies:
Technical Stack
- Debezium: Change Data Capture (CDC) for real-time replication
- Airbyte: Data ingestion and transformation pipeline
- DBT: Data modeling and transformation layer
- BigQuery: Cloud data warehouse for analytics
- Cloud SQL: Managed MySQL for operational data
- Terraform: Infrastructure as Code for deployment
Migration Architecture
Our migration strategy followed a phased approach with real-time replication and minimal downtime, ensuring continuous operations throughout the migration process.
Legacy to Cloud Migration Architecture
Legacy Phase
- • MySQL bottlenecks
- • 5-10s response times
- • 5TB data volume
- • Hardware limitations
Migration Phase
- • Debezium CDC
- • Airbyte ingestion
- • DBT transformations
- • Real-time replication
Cloud Phase
- • Cloud SQL operational
- • BigQuery analytics
- • 25% cost savings
- • Scalable architecture
Technical Implementation
1. Change Data Capture with Debezium
Implemented real-time data replication from MySQL to cloud systems:
The full configuration reference is available on request.
2. Data Pipeline with Airbyte
Built robust data ingestion pipeline:
The full configuration reference is available on request.
3. Data Transformation with DBT
Implemented data modeling:
The full data warehouse query reference is available on request.
4. Migration Strategy and Timeline
Implemented a phased migration approach:
The full data warehouse query reference is available on request.
Measurable Results
- Data Migrated
- 5TB
- Downtime
- 3 min
- Cost Savings
- —
- Daily Transactions
- 10M+
- Uptime availability
- High
- Query Response
- < 1s
- Operations
- 24/7
- Data Loss
- 0
Performance Improvements
Before Migration
- Query Response: 5-10 seconds during peak hours
- Backup Time: 8+ hours
- Scaling: Manual vertical scaling required
- Uptime: 99.5% with frequent maintenance windows
- Cost: High hardware and maintenance costs
After Migration
- Query Response: < 1 second consistently
- Backup Time: 15 minutes with automated snapshots
- Scaling: Automatic horizontal scaling
- Uptime: 99.9% with zero-downtime deployments
- Cost: meaningful reduction in total infrastructure costs
Migration Benefits
Operational Improvements
- Real-time Processing: Sub-second data replication across systems
- Automated Scaling: Dynamic resource allocation based on demand
- Disaster Recovery: Multi-region backup and failover capabilities
- Monitoring: observability and alerting
- Compliance: Enhanced audit trails and data governance
Business Impact
- User Experience: Faster betting interface and real-time updates
- Revenue Growth: Support for higher transaction volumes
- Market Expansion: Ability to enter new markets and jurisdictions
- Feature Development: Faster deployment of new betting features
- Risk Management: Improved fraud detection and compliance monitoring
Migration Template
Our implementation provides a migration template that includes:
- CDC Configuration
- Data Pipeline Setup
- Validation Procedures
- Rollback Strategies
- Performance Testing
- Monitoring Setup
- Documentation
- Training Materials
Call to Action
Ready to modernize your legacy data infrastructure? Clone our migration template and start your journey:
Conclusion
The legacy to cloud migration demonstrates that large-scale data migration can be achieved with minimal disruption while delivering significant performance improvements. By leveraging modern migration technologies and a well-planned migration strategy, Luce achieved:
- Zero Data Loss: Complete data integrity throughout migration
- Minimal Downtime: production-grade uptime during critical migration period
- Performance Improvement: materially faster query performance
- Scalability: Cloud-native architecture supporting future growth
- Operational Continuity: Seamless transition with no business disruption
This project serves as a blueprint for other organizations seeking to modernize legacy data infrastructure while maintaining operational continuity. The migration template provides a proven framework for achieving similar results across different industries and data volumes.